projects
/
deliverable
/
linux.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
WorkStruct: make allyesconfig
[deliverable/linux.git]
/
drivers
/
net
/
cassini.c
diff --git
a/drivers/net/cassini.c
b/drivers/net/cassini.c
index 521c5b71023c60c5ba1199268d1d441bfac03ce1..fe08f3845491179aa70265f6bfb8ac3d5165021f 100644
(file)
--- a/
drivers/net/cassini.c
+++ b/
drivers/net/cassini.c
@@
-4066,9
+4066,9
@@
static int cas_alloc_rxds(struct cas *cp)
return 0;
}
return 0;
}
-static void cas_reset_task(
void *data
)
+static void cas_reset_task(
struct work_struct *work
)
{
{
- struct cas *cp =
(struct cas *) data
;
+ struct cas *cp =
container_of(work, struct cas, reset_task)
;
#if 0
int pending = atomic_read(&cp->reset_task_pending);
#else
#if 0
int pending = atomic_read(&cp->reset_task_pending);
#else
@@
-5006,7
+5006,7
@@
static int __devinit cas_init_one(struct pci_dev *pdev,
atomic_set(&cp->reset_task_pending_spare, 0);
atomic_set(&cp->reset_task_pending_mtu, 0);
#endif
atomic_set(&cp->reset_task_pending_spare, 0);
atomic_set(&cp->reset_task_pending_mtu, 0);
#endif
- INIT_WORK(&cp->reset_task, cas_reset_task
, cp
);
+ INIT_WORK(&cp->reset_task, cas_reset_task);
/* Default link parameters */
if (link_mode >= 0 && link_mode <= 6)
/* Default link parameters */
if (link_mode >= 0 && link_mode <= 6)
This page took
0.023825 seconds
and
5
git commands to generate.